#4ccf0e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ccf0e is composed of 29.8% red, 81.2%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.2%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 100.7 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#4ccf0e color hex could be obtained by blending #98ff1c with #009f00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#4ccf0e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020500 is the darkest color, while #f6fef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ccf0e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d726c is the less saturated color, while #49d806 is the most saturated one.
